Correct me if I am wrong. After expanding large object API to 64-bit, the max size of a large object will be 8TB(assuming 8KB default BLKSZ).
large object max size = pageno(int32) * LOBLKSIZE = (2^32-1) * (BLCKSZ / 4) = (2^32-1) * (8192/4) = 8TB I just want to confirm my calculation is correct. -- Tatsuo Ishii SRA OSS, Inc.
